Gaining Familiarity with XML Structure

The term “XML formatting” refers to the steps used to make XML code more aesthetically pleasing and organized. Element indentation, attribute alignment, and line break placement are all part of the process. By automating it with an XML formatter, you can save time and effort while improving the readability of your code.

What can an XML formatter do for you?

  • Improving Readability: Errors can be more easily found and fixed when XML is properly formatted.
  • Uniformity: With the help of an XML formatter, you can be certain that your code will always seem standardized and professional.
  • Efficiency: Manual formatting is labor-intensive and error-prone. A more efficient and effective method is to use an XML formatter.

An Introduction to XML Formatters

In just a few easy steps, you can start using an XML formatter:

Pick an Appropriate XML Formatter

You can find a number of XML formatters on the web. Choose the one that best fits your needs and tastes.

Paste the XML code here

Make sure to paste your XML code into the input box of the formatter.

Formatting Options

You can usually change things like line width and indentation style with most formatters. Make the necessary adjustments so they suit your tastes.

Press the “Format” or “Beautify” button to apply the rules for formatting to your XML code.

Take a look at the XML code and make any necessary edits before saving it to use in your projects.

Recommended Methods for XML Document Structure

If you want your XML to be as efficient as possible, follow these guidelines:

  • Improve code readability by consistently using a common indentation style.
  • For a more polished look, you can align XML attributes.
  • To avoid awkwardly long lines and make your code easier to understand, use line breaks.
  • An important or complicated part of your XML code can be explained by adding comments to it.
